A device (1) for detachably connecting two abutting structural parts (2, 3) comprises a tie member (4), adapted to be at least partially inserted in a recess (5) formed in a first (2) of the structural parts (2, 3), and a locking element (6) operable to be disposed in a second (3) of the structural parts (2, 3) and to cooperate with an engagement surface (14, 45) of a rod member (10), slidably housed in a body (8) of the tie member (4), to pull the same towards the second structural part (3). The body (8) is provided with a first, expandable, portion (9) adapted to frictionally engage the recess (5) and with an engaging zone (13) cooperating with an expander region (12) of the rod member (10) operable to expand the first, expandable, portion (9) of the body (8) upon displacement of the rod member (10) relative to the same. The rod member (10) is provided with a traction portion (15) radially outwardly extending therefrom and adapted to cooperate with abutment means (16) radially formed in the body (8) of the tie member (4) at a predetermined axial distance from the engaging zone (13) to effect a substantially simultaneous displacement towards the second structural part (3) of the first, expandable, portion (9) of the body (8) of the tie member (4) and of the first structural part (2) in frictional engagement therewith.
